Paul Norman HAMILTON

HAMILTON, Paul Norman

Service Number: 505
Enlisted: 30 September 1916, Toowoomba, Qld.
Last Rank: Private
Last Unit: 3rd Machine Gun Battalion
Born: Toowoomba, Qld., 1895
Home Town: Toowoomba, Toowoomba, Queensland
Schooling: Toowoomba Grammar School
Occupation: Surveyor's Assistant
Died: Illness, France, 8 August 1918
Cemetery: Crouy British Cemetery, Crouy-sur-Somme
V A 12, Crouy British Cemetery, Crouy St Pierre, Amiens, Picardie, France
Memorials: Australian War Memorial Roll of Honour, Toowoomba Grammar School WW1 Honour Board, Toowoomba Grammar School WW1 In Memoriam Honour Board, Toowoomba Roll of Honour WW1, Toowoomba St Luke's Church WW1 Honour Roll, Toowoomba War Memorial (Mothers' Memorial)

Biography contributed by Faithe Jones

Son of John Edward and Katherine Florence HAMILTON of Campbell Street, Toowoomba.

Mrs. J.E. Hamilton, of Godrey and Campbell Streets, has received warod from the Authorities that her second son Paul Norman, had contracted pneumonia an died in France on August 8th.  Paul Hamilton was a powerfully built and prominent runner and footballer here before he enlisted two years ago.
